Where is Monti Guest House - Affittacamere, Rome?

Where is Monti Guest House - Affittacamere, Rome located?

Monti Guest House - Affittacamere, Rome, Monti Guest House - Affittacamere, Rome, Italy (approx. 41.89574°, 12.4934°)


Where is Monti Guest House - Affittacamere, Rome on the map?